CONSULTATION MEETING FOR COMPILATION OF THE GUIDELINE HANDBOOK ON SKILLS FOR ASSISTING PEOPLE WITH HEARING LOSS IN HOSPITALS

 

On Sunday, August 15, 2021, CED organized the consultation meeting for the outline of “The Guideline Handbook on Skills for Assisting People with Hearing Loss in Hospitals.” The meeting had interesting discussions and noted many helpful ideas from 14 people who are experts from various fields such as doctors, health care staff, psychologist, teachers of students with hearing loss, lawyer, gender expert, social workers…

 

This is an activity of the project “Promoting the initial legal support and implementation of regulations on medical examination and treatment for people with hearing loss (deaf, hard of hearing and deafened)” of CED, sponsored by EU through JIFF-Oxfam.
